June 8, 2006

Jason Weber Named Men's & Women's Swimming Coach

CHICAGO -- University of Chicago Director of Athletics Tom Weingartner announced today the appointment of Jason Weber as head men's and women's swimming coach and director of aquatics.

Weber has served as Chicago's assistant men's swimming coach and assistant aquatics director for the past two years. In that capacity, he has been involved in all phases of coaching, recruiting, and administration.

"This is a dream job for me, and it is exciting to know that I will be able to continue my career at such a prominent institution," said Weber. "I look forward to working with the distinguished and accomplished faculty and staff at Chicago. With our amazing aquatics facility, this is an exciting time be a part of the Chicago swimming family."

"Jason has earned the respect of his student-athletes, been actively involved in recruiting two classes to the swimming program, participated extensively in the management of the aquatics facility, and served as an enthusiastic and skilled instructor in our masters swim program. With one of the premier aquatics facilities in the country, I believe that he is ready  to assume the head coaching responsibilities and develop our program into one of the best in the nation," said Weingartner.

Prior to his arrival at Chicago in the fall of 2004, Weber served as a sport partnership intern for the United States Olympic Committee in 2003 and as an assistant age group coach for Conejo Simi Aquatics in Thousand Oaks, California, from October 2002 to August 2003.

Weber is a 2002 graduate of Brown University with a bachelor's degree in psychology. He was a member of the Brown swimming team from 1998-2002 and in 2000 competed in the United States Olympic Trials. He received a master's degree in sports management from the University of San Francisco in 2004.
